Default 2000 civic SI muffler on my GS-R ????

So i'm wanting to go back to stock exhaust on my GS-R. all I have right now is a custom axle back with a Tanabe Medallion muffler. After trying to find a stock GS-R muffler for about 2 months now (sheesh), I realized that I still have my 2000 Civic SI muffler in my garage. Will that muffler fit on my GS-R? Would that muffler look absolutely retarded on there? I really wanted to get an oem GS-R one but if it will fit, what the hector eh?

I had an axleback made for a civc on my GSR for a while. Lines up no problem, just the hangers are a strech. they are like 2 or 3 inches apart on the tegs but the civic they are like 5 inches apart, so it wants to pull the exhaust up a little highter than it should be.
